NoSQL databases provide a variety of benefits including flexible data models, horizontal scaling, lightning fast queries, and ease of use for developers. NoSQL databases come in a variety of types including document databases, key-values databases, wide-column stores, and graph databases. MongoDB is the world's most popular NoSQL database. Following are the NoSQL Features: 1. Non-relational. NoSQL databases don’t follow the relational model nor does it provide tables that have flat fixed-column records. They work with self-contained aggregates or BLOBs. A NoSQL database doesn’t require data normalization and object-relational mapping.NoSQL databases allow the data to be stored in ways that are more intuitive and easier to understand, or closer to the way the data is used by applications—with fewer transformations required when storing or retrieving using NoSQL-style APIs. Moreover, NoSQL databases can take full advantage of the cloud to deliver zero downtime.Interestingly, Strozzi’s NoSQL database does in fact employ the relational model, meaning that the original NoSQL database doesn’t fit the contemporary definition of NoSQL. Because “NoSQL” generally refers to any DBMS that doesn’t employ the relational model, there are several operational data models associated with the NoSQL concept.

NoSQL databases tend to be horizontally scaled; that is the data is stored on one of many individual stand-alone systems which run relatively simple processes, such as key look-ups, or read/write against a few records, against their own data. The individual system onto which the data itself will be stored will be managed according to a key.

The main difference between an SQL and a NoSQL database lies in how they are structured. A relational database—based in SQL—depends on the strictly defined relationships between tables. To retrieve information contained in the database, a user can refer to the specific search query language to match common characteristics across one …

An in-memory database is a purpose-built database that relies primarily on internal memory for data storage. It enables minimal response times by eliminating the need to access standard disk drives (SSDs). Hypertable is NoSQL open-source database that was designed to combat the scalability problem that appears in all relational databases. It was based on the Google Big Table design and written in C++. Hypertable runs in both Linux and Mac OS X. NoSQL databases were created in response to the limitations of traditional relational database technology. When compared to relational databases, NoSQL databases are often more scalable and provide superior performance. In addition, the flexibility and ease of use of their data models can speed development in comparison to the relational model ...
